Quick Brief

The Department of the Treasury is procuring hotel occupancy services for conferencing and lodging support related to the Uniform Commission Examination Program. The contract will be firm-fixed-price for a period of 5 years, including a 6-month base period and four 12-month option periods, with an ultimate completion date of May 2031. Quoters must comply with prevailing wage determinations and confirm the provision of complimentary rooms for site visits.

Description

The purpose of this solicitation amendment is to provide the Government's answers to Industry's

questions via the revised Attachment K - OCC HOCL

Questions and Answers Worksheet for potential Quoters' consideration. (SEE ATTACHMENT K - OCC HOCL SUPPORT_QA WKSHEET-GOVT FOR ADDITIONAL DETAILS) ORIGINAL POST (APRIL 2,

2026) Pursuant to Federal Acquisition Regulation (FAR) 13.5— Simplified Procedures for Certain Commercial Products and Commercial Services, the (OCC) is releasing this request for quotation (RFQ), i.e., solicitationin an effort to procure OCC Hotel Occupancy for Conferencing and Lodging (HOCL) Support to the Uniform Commission Examination (UCE) Program. As a reminder, Quoters must comply with the base rate and fringe benefit rate

requirements of the prevailing Wage Determinations, where applicable, as proposed. Should the best suited Quoter be an OTSB (i.e., Large Business), it will be required to submit a Commercial Plan in lieu of a Subcontracting Plan. The best suited Quoter will need to confirm at time of notice to participate in Factor 5 (Site Visit) whether complimentary rooms will be provided for the 1-night stay.
